Types of Fractures Understanding the different types of fractures is crucial for determining the most suitable treatment. Each type requires a specific approach to ensure the bone heals correctly. Dr. Omer Sheriff offers customized treatment plans for all fracture types, whether the injury is simple or complicated.

  2. Common types of fractures include:  Simple Fracture: A clean break where the bone remains under the skin, typically not involving any external puncture.  Compound Fracture: A break where the bone pierces through the skin, exposing the bone to infection and increasing the severity of the injury.  Greenstick Fracture: Incomplete fractures, often seen in children, where the bone bends and cracks but does not fully break.  Comminuted Fracture: A fracture where the bone shatters into several pieces, requiring more advanced methods of repair.  Spiral Fracture: A fracture that occurs due to a twisting motion, resulting in a spiral- shaped break in the bone. Symptoms of a Fracture Recognizing the symptoms of a fracture is vital for ensuring timely treatment. The symptoms can vary based on the type and severity of the fracture, but some common signs include:  Intense pain that worsens with movement or pressure on the injured area.  Swelling around the affected site, which may indicate internal bleeding or inflammation.  Bruising or discoloration of the skin near the fracture.  Deformity, where the affected limb or bone appears misaligned or out of shape.  Inability to bear weight or move the injured part, particularly in fractures of the legs or arms. Causes of Fractures Fractures can occur for a variety of reasons, often resulting from a combination of external force and underlying factors that weaken the bone. Dr. Omer Sheriff addresses the full spectrum of causes that can lead to fractures, ensuring the right treatment for each patient.

  3. Accidents: Road accidents, falls, and workplace injuries are among the most common causes of fractures. These incidents can cause simple to complex bone breaks that require immediate medical attention.  Sports Injuries: Athletes or active individuals are particularly prone to fractures due to high-impact activities, sudden falls, or physical collisions.  Medical Conditions: Conditions such as osteoporosis, cancer, or other diseases that weaken the bones can increase the likelihood of fractures. These conditions require specialized fracture care to support bone recovery.  Other Factors: Repetitive strain, poor posture, or improper lifting techniques can also contribute to stress fractures, especially in the lower limbs or spine. Diagnosis of Fractures Accurate diagnosis is the first step toward effective treatment. Dr. Omer Sheriff uses advanced diagnostic tools to assess fractures, determining the type, location, and severity of the injury to develop the best treatment plan.  Physical Examination: A thorough examination of the injured area helps the doctor assess visible symptoms like swelling, tenderness, and deformity.  X-rays: The most common imaging technique used to identify bone fractures. X-rays allow for a detailed look at the break and its alignment.  CT Scans and MRIs: For more complex fractures, such as those involving the spine or multiple bones, CT scans and MRIs provide detailed cross-sectional images that help in forming an accurate diagnosis. Treatment of Bone Fractures The treatment for fractures depends on the severity of the injury, the type of fracture, and the location of the break. Dr. Omer Sheriff offers a range of advanced treatments tailored to meet the needs of each patient. Whether it's a simple fracture or a more complicated break, Dr. Sheriff provides the highest standard of care.  Casting and Splinting: For simple fractures, a cast or splint is used to immobilize the bone and promote healing. This method is often used for fractures in the limbs.  Traction: In cases where bones need to be gradually pulled into proper alignment, traction therapy is used. This method helps to realign bones without requiring surgery.

  4. Surgical Options: oInternal Fixation: For more severe fractures, surgical intervention may be needed to insert screws, rods, or plates into the bone to stabilize it and facilitate healing. oExternal Fixation: For complex fractures, external fixation involves the use of metal pins and frames to stabilize the bones from outside the body, ensuring proper alignment and healing. In addition to the surgical treatments, post-treatment care, including physical therapy, plays an essential role in regaining strength, flexibility, and mobility. Prevention of Fractures While fractures can occur unexpectedly, there are proactive steps you can take to reduce the risk. Dr. Omer Sheriff emphasizes the importance of lifestyle choices that promote bone health and prevent fractures.  Diet: Consuming a diet rich in calcium and vitamin D helps to maintain strong bones and reduce the risk of fractures. Dairy products, leafy greens, and fortified foods are excellent sources.  Exercise: Regular physical activity, including weight-bearing exercises such as walking and strength training, helps to maintain bone density and prevent bone loss.  Safety Precautions: Wearing appropriate safety gear during sports and physical activities can help protect bones from injury. Using proper techniques for lifting heavy objects also reduces strain on bones.  Managing Medical Conditions: Conditions like osteoporosis can weaken bones, so addressing them with medical treatment and lifestyle adjustments is key to reducing fracture risk. By incorporating these habits into your daily routine, you can strengthen your bones and reduce the likelihood of fractures.
